Today we are all united against terror. But share the emotion is not enough to give a new course to history, to restore meaning and dignity to the human condition. We must work together on two major challenges:
 
- understand that politics must regain a complex nature, mediation and project. Today, faced with the phenomena of transnational crime (whatever they are called) that reconfigure the institutions to their interests, we need above all a decision-making capacity of vision, prevention, contrast;
 
- strategically rethink the limits of "linear thinking", which causes war in various forms, and give life to a "complex thought" on global reality. We need a comprehensive reform of living together that recognizes the interrelationships that characterize the present world. We need to overcome the self-referentiality of the competitive model to enhance the integration of globally cooperative processes. Only then, in fact, globalization can be truly global.
 
Marching against terror is important but, in the absence of a project of civilization, is likely to be the empty exercise of an international community that does not exist.
